Transaction e96ec58e4198198dfdceefaba4392ac9cd27afa93387c01c98e1e7879f903f7b
1 Input
1 Output
-
e96ec58e4198198dfdceefaba4392ac9cd27afa93387c01c98e1e7879f903f7b:0
- value
- 49990877
- script pubkey
- OP_0 OP_PUSHBYTES_20 8da663c1773d6fa34004febdd2cf8002845b1554
- address
- bc1q3knx8sth84h6xsqyl67a9nuqq2z9k925utf7s2